Touring in a Pink Jeep

For folks seeking a convenient and ready-made commercial introduction to Death Valley that is as close as the telephone, Pink Jeep Tours of Las Vegas, Nevada may be an option. Here is what the company has to say about the excursion on their website, pinkjeep.com:

“Death Valley comes to life when Pink Jeep Tours shows you the most spectacular highlights of the largest national park in the contiguous United States. En route, we’ll pass by Mercury, former home of atomic weapons testing, and we’ll venture into the fascinating ghost town of Rhyolite, home to rustic ruins from the past as well as the Goldwell Open Air Museum. In the park, you’ll be amazed by an abundance of astounding natural features, and the awesome history that abounds in this extremely desolate and unique National Treasure. The journey continues with stops at Furnace Creek, Devil’s Golf Course, Badwater, Zabriskie Point, and more. From seasonal snow-capped peaks, to the lowest point in the Western Hemisphere, the incredible memories you take home from this tour will last a lifetime.”

This is a seasonal tour, and does not operate during the summer months. The trip is ten hours in duration, visitors are picked up at their hotel.
